The cheapest way to get from Mizen Head to Doolin is to drive and train and bus which costs €40 - €70 and takes 8h 19m.
The fastest way to get from Mizen Head to Doolin is to drive which takes 3h 51m and costs €45 - €70.
No, there is no direct bus from Mizen Head to Doolin. However, there are services departing from Mizen Head and arriving at Doolin via Skibbereen, Cork Bus Station and Ennis Station.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 10h 4m.
The distance between Mizen Head and Doolin is 359 km. The road distance is 273.8 km.
